    I'm my previous post i was bitching about the engine moveig when decelerating/accelerating in my manual 6 speed GTP. Well i've odered a Stillen engine shock dampener oringinaly for a infinity g35 and it FITS perfectly!!! I realy didn't have to do to much modification to it besides drilling out the stock dampener rivits and buing new 10mm allen head bolts to bolt it in place. I got it from http://www.vividracing.com/catalog/prod ... ts_id/6967 . I didn't know if it would fit when I bought it and thought I would have to make custom brackets. But my gamble equals everyones gain! Once I drilled the rivits out I had to drill the holes big enouf to accept a 10mm bolt but this install is realy easy. Heres some pics:

                            • #15
                              Well they make the engine more rigid, like when you romp on the gas the engine won't kick back as hard. But as far as reducing the shaking, the stock mounts are best for that, you will notice increased vibrations but some people like it since it gives it a 'performance feeling'

                              But I'm sure this dampener can't be near that bad, I was just speaking from past experiences. I replaced the same thing on my 350z and I didn't feel any negative effects from it. But with prothane motor mounts whoa it was bad poor thing was going to shake apart, mind you it did break in and calm down but you could still notice it easily.
